Introduction to Cut to Length Line Flying Shear Stacker

The Cut to Length Line Flying Shear Stacker is an automated production system designed for precise shearing of metal coils into fixed-length plates. This innovative equipment is engineered to handle coils of varying widths and thicknesses, delivering products with exact dimensions and smooth surfaces. Developed by HEBEI AIS MACHINERY EQUIPMENT CO.,LTD, a leading manufacturer in metal processing machinery, the system integrates multiple functional modules to ensure efficiency, stability, and precision in industrial applications.

Core Features and Functional Modules

The Cut to Length Line Flying Shear Stacker is composed of a series of interconnected modules, each contributing to its seamless operation. Key components include:

  • Loading Coil Car: Efficiently transports raw coils to the processing area.
  • Single-Arm Uncoiler Device: Unwinds metal coils with minimal tension, ensuring uniform feeding.
  • Feeding Bridge and Hydraulic Buffer Transition Bridge: Maintain consistent material flow and absorb shocks during high-speed operations.
  • Automatic Shearing Cut to Length System: Utilizes advanced sensors and controls for precise cutting.
  • High-Precision Leveling Machine: Ensures flatness and dimensional accuracy of the final product.
  • Servo-Controlled Cutoff Device: Delivers rapid and accurate separation of cut lengths.
  • Transverse Shearing Unit: Handles cross-cutting for complex shapes.
  • Conveyor Belt System and Flap Unloading Rack: Streamlines material movement and storage.
  • Automatic Stacking Device: Organizes finished products for easy retrieval.
  • Unloading Coil Car and Servo Drive/Hydraulic Control Unit: Completes the cycle with automated unloading and power management.

Technical Specifications

Parameter Specification
Processing Capacity Up to 150-300 meters per minute (adjustable based on material thickness)
Maximum Coil Weight Up to 10 tons (depending on coil diameter)
Material Thickness Range 0.5-3.0 mm (customizable for specialized applications)
Width Tolerance ±0.1 mm (ensured by high-precision leveling and shearing systems)
Power Supply 380V, 50Hz, 3-phase AC
Control System PLC-based automation with HMI interface for real-time monitoring
Hydraulic System High-pressure, low-noise design with redundant safety features
Dimensions Approx. 25m (length) x 4m (width) x 3m (height)

Applications in Industrial Settings

This system is widely used in industries requiring high-volume, high-precision metal processing. Key applications include:

  • Automotive Manufacturing: Producing stamped parts and sheet metal components with tight tolerances.
  • Construction: Supplying pre-cut steel plates for structural frameworks and cladding.
  • Appliance Production: Creating components for refrigerators, washing machines, and other household appliances.
  • Shipbuilding: Fabricating plates for hulls and internal structures.
  • Energy Sector: Manufacturing parts for wind turbines and solar panel frames.

The system's adaptability makes it suitable for both small-scale workshops and large-scale production facilities. Its modular design allows for easy integration into existing production lines, reducing installation time and costs.

Small Impeder, Big Impact: How It Determines Your Weld Quality

An impeder is a critical component in ERW tube mill high-frequency welding, installed inside the tube to guide magnetic flux and concentrate heat on the strip edges. With a high-quality ferrite core, it improves welding efficiency, stabilizes seam quality, and reduces energy consumption. Impeders work together with the high-frequency induction coil, squeeze rollers, and cooling systems, ensuring uniform heating and stronger welds. Available in rod, return-flow, and high-temperature types, they are essential for consistent, efficient, and high-quality ERW tube production.

What Is a Slitting Line? Key Equipment and Functions Explained

A Slitting Line is a high-precision coil processing system designed to uncoil, level, slit, and rewind steel coils into accurate narrow strips. It is widely used in ERW tube mills, metal fabrication, automotive parts, and steel service centers. With a high-precision slitting head, stable tension control, and efficient recoiling, the Slitting Line ensures burr-free edges, consistent strip width, and high-speed production. It supports HR/CR steel, stainless steel, galvanized steel, aluminum, and copper coils.

Horizontal vs Vertical vs Cage vs Disc Accumulator for ERW Tube Mills

In an ERW tube mill, accumulators store steel strip to maintain continuous feeding during coil changeovers. The most widely used designs are Horizontal Spiral, Vertical Spiral, Cage Loop, and Disc Type. Each type suits different line speeds, strip dimensions, and workshop layouts.
